In this manner, are hydrocarbons toxic?

Ingestion of hydrocarbons, such as petroleum distillates (eg, gasoline, kerosene, mineral oil, lamp oil, paint thinners), results in minimal systemic effects but can cause severe aspiration pneumonitis. Toxic potential mainly depends on viscosity, measured in Saybolt seconds universal (SSU).

Beside above, how do hydrocarbons affect the human body? Swallowed hydrocarbons cause coughing and choking, which allows the hydrocarbon liquid to enter the airways and irritate the lungs, a serious condition in itself (chemical pneumonitis), and can lead to severe pneumonia.

Thereof, are hydrocarbon solvents toxic?

Methanol. Like most hydrocarbon solvents, methanol (methyl alcohol) can produce reversible sensory irritation and narcosis at airborne concentrations below those producing organ system pathology. Serious methanol toxicity is most commonly associated with ingestion.

What products contain hydrocarbons?

Some common household products that contain hydrocarbons are mineral oil based cosmetics like bath oil, creams, lotions, and makeup removers. Other types of products include gasoline additives, motor oil, and waterproofing agents.

What causes hydrocarbons?

Hydrocarbon emissions are simply unburned fuel being pumped raw into the exhaust system. Misfiring is the most likely culprit, and that can come from an ignition problem, or an internal engine failure that reduces compression.

Is isoparaffinic hydrocarbon safe to inhale?

Isoparaffins have a very low order of acute toxicity, being practically non-toxic by oral, dermal and inhalation routes. However, aspiration of liquid isoparaffins into the lungs during oral ingestion could result in severe pulmonary injury.

What do you mean by hydrocarbons?

Hydrocarbons: Definition A hydrocarbon is an organic compound made of nothing more than carbons and hydrogens. It is possible for double or triple bonds to form between carbon atoms and even for structures, such as rings, to form. Saturated hydrocarbons have as many hydrogen atoms as possible attached to every carbon.

How are hydrocarbons useful?

Hydrocarbons. Hydrocarbons are organic molecules consisting entirely of carbon and hydrogen. They make good fuels because their covalent bonds store a large amount of energy, which is released when the molecules are burned (i.e., when they react with oxygen to form carbon dioxide and water).

Is Hydrocarbon harmful to humans?

Hydrocarbons are oily liquids. Many are not harmful unless the oily liquid gets into the lungs. However, if it enters the lungs, it can cause a pneumonia-like condition; irreversible, permanent lung damage; and even death.

How do solvents affect the body?

Solvents, their vapours and mists have various effects on human health. Many of them have a narcotic effect, causing fatigue, dizziness and intoxication. High doses may lead to unconsciousness and death. Solvents may damage the liver, kidneys, heart, blood vessels, bone marrow and the nervous system.

Are organic solvents dangerous?

Organic solvents can be carcinogens, reproductive hazards, and neurotoxins. Carcinogenic organic solvents include benzene, carbon tetrachloride, and trichloroethylene. Organic solvents recognized as neurotoxins include n-hexane, tetrachloroethylene, and toluene.

Are hydrocarbons flammable?

Many hydrocarbons are highly flammable; therefore, care should be taken to prevent injury. If hydrocarbons undergo combustion in tight areas, toxic carbon monoxide can form.

Why are solvents dangerous?

Solvents can make you ill by: Breathing vapours – paints etc give off solvent vapours as they dry or cure. Skin contact – some solvents can be absorbed through the skin. Repeated or prolonged skin contact with liquid solvents may cause burns or dermatitis.

Are solvents chemicals?

The term 'solvent' is applied to a large number of chemical substances which are used to dissolve or dilute other substances or materials. They are usually organic liquids. Many solvents are also used as chemical intermediates, fuels, and as components of a wide range of products.

Are organic solvents flammable?

Most organic solvents are flammable or highly flammable, depending on their volatility. Exceptions are some chlorinated solvents like dichloromethane and chloroform.
